Abstract

The article presents a detailed statistical approach for the valorization of hemicellulosic liquor obtained from sunflower stalks, focusing on its potential in biosurfactant production. It highlights the significance of lignocellulosic biomass as a renewable and abundant resource, emphasizing its role in reducing dependence on petroleum-derived products. The study investigates the use of sunflower stalks, a widely available agro-industrial waste, as a sustainable feedstock for biosurfactant production. Through an alkaline pretreatment process, the hemicellulosic fraction is extracted, providing a rich source of fermentable sugars for microbial fermentation. The research employs a Central Composite Design (CCD) to optimize the production conditions, evaluating the influence of hemicellulosic liquor, glucose, and mineral salt solution on biosurfactant yield. The results demonstrate the potential of hemicellulosic liquor as a partial substitute for glucose, offering a cost-effective and eco-friendly alternative for biosurfactant production. The study also explores the properties of the produced biosurfactants, including their surface tension reduction and emulsification capabilities, suggesting their applicability in various industrial sectors such as environmental remediation and enhanced oil recovery. The detailed statistical analysis and optimization techniques presented in the article provide valuable insights for advancing sustainable bioprocesses and valorizing lignocellulosic waste.
